## Formula sandbox tuning

User-supplied formulas in Gridmoor execute inside a restricted interpreter with hard ceilings on time, memory, and call depth. Reviewers should confirm any change to these ceilings is justified in the PR description, since raising them widens the abuse surface. Defaults were chosen from production traces. The current limits are as follows.

limits module of tafog-fawip:
WEIGHTS = {
    "julix": 57,
    "lamys": 992,
    "kasvan": 209,
    "quenok": 750,
    "alddor": 259,
    "oliath": 1009,
    "wenix": 815,
}

Audit item 7 — Graphviz access controls, Tanglemap

Confirm the Tanglemap dependency graph visualizer renders only repos the viewer can read. Verify: token scopes enforced at query time, no cached graphs served cross-tenant, export endpoint disabled in shared mode. Check stale-node pruning runs nightly and logs to the audit sink. New team members: do not grant admin on the graph store without a ticket. Evidence goes in the audit folder, one screenshot per check. Sign-off is required from the component owner, whose name follows below.

account owner for yahag-taguf: Ulaael Istox

## Further Reading

The Garagelight occupancy feed updates every thirty seconds from sensor controllers in each deck of the Fennwick garages. Support tickets about stale counts usually trace back to a controller that missed two consecutive heartbeats; the feed then marks that deck as "estimated" rather than dropping it. Escalation thresholds, sensor naming conventions, and the estimation fallback logic are all documented on the internal wiki page for the feed.

dashboard of bahip-bagug = https://artifactory.xolmarcloud.example/browse/secrets/pipeline/job/pipeline/ticket/pipeline/00c6821e1847bc71466a6753

Capacity note for support: the Skimmerly nightly search reindex currently finishes in about 3.1 hours against a 5-hour window. Document volume is growing roughly 8% per month, so expect the window to tighten by early next quarter. If customers report stale results in the morning, check whether the shard fan-out stage overran. We size the job using the following constants, reviewed monthly. The current values appear below.

tuning table, yajog-yahof:
BUDGETS = {
    "lamvan": 303,
    "wenox": 460,
    "fenvan": 525,
}